Developed as part of the open-source tool Zardaxt.py GitHub Repository by security researcher NikolaiT (Incolumitas), this scoring algorithm evaluates the unique way different operating systems configure their network packets. By generating a percentage-based compatibility matrix across major operating systems, platforms like BrowserLeaks TCP/IP Fingerprinting utilize Zardaxt scoring to expose spoofed User-Agents, hidden proxies, and unauthorized VPN tunnels.
